Abstract
The invention relates to a closed pressure-bearing easily-detached brick for a mine roadway. The closed pressure-bearing easily-detached brick comprises a hollow brick body. The closed pressure-bearing easily-detached brick is characterized in that the hollow brick body is of a cube shape, wherein two insulation walls are arranged in the hollow brick body, and the thickness of the insulation walls is 20mm; and holes are formed in the insulation walls, fixed bulges are respectively arranged at four corners at the upper part the hollow brick body, grooves are respectively formed in four corners at the lower part of the hollow brick body and are matched with the bulges, the thickness of a sealing wall at the upper part of the hollow brick body is 10mm, the thickness of a sealing wall at the lower part of the hollow brick body is 20mm, hollow brick body is filled with sand, one-way teeth are arranged on the outer side of the hollow brick body, and the angles of the one-way teeth are 20-45 degrees.

Technical background
Removing fire dam is ambulance corps when processing mine fire accident, a regular safe practice sex work.At present, each underground coal mine mostly carries out block with work stone or square brick and closes.When removing fire dam, due on market but without special instrument of decoding preferably, broken close particularly difficult;Particularly highly gassy mine, for instance: in 2005 Nian Fumei companies 3 during 217 airtight dismounting, due to what make with work stone, rescue team member when breaking seal airtight, continuous operation 12 hours, just removed, broken to close the time long, and security risk is big, affects the safety of rescue team member.When implementing to abolish airtight, key is how quickly to be beaten by fire dam to open a gap, and then quickly removes fire dam.

Detailed description of the invention:
Below in conjunction with Figure of description, 1 ~ 2 couple of present invention is further described:
1, size: 240mm(length) × 240mm(width) × 11mm(height);370mm(length) × 240mm(width) × 11mm(height);
2, bearing pressure: 20 tons;
3, square brick frame wall gauge: 10mm;Divider wall gauge: 20mm;The end: 20mm;Face: 10mm;
4, raw material composition: 425# portland cement, sand (or microlith);Different according to intensity, cement and sand proportioning are typically chosen 1:2 or 1:3;
Charges: sand.
Three, processing technology
Production machine is utilized to be divided into three steps: to make framework 1;Carry out filling sand 2;Carry out capping 3;Then compacting forms.
Four, target is reached
When fire dam built by mine, it is possible to serve as plugging material and directly build in fire dam;When removing fire dam, directly the mine laneway readily removable fragment of brick of airtight pressure-bearing is abolished, it is possible to quickly remove fire dam, ensure the safety of rescue personnel.
Just utilize the special fragment of brick of part when fire dam starts to construct, be embedded in fire dam, implement to close.This special fragment of brick is when breaking seal airtight, it is easy to abolish, it is possible to quickly break an aperture by force by airtight, then quickly by airtight strong all dismountings.This special fragment of brick we term it: the readily removable fragment of brick of the airtight pressure-bearing of mine laneway.The readily removable fragment of brick of the airtight pressure-bearing of this mine laneway have resistance to compression, antiknock, intensity height, high temperature-proof, fire-retardant, be easy to carry, the function such as easy to use, cost is low, size according to mine sealing wall, design 240,370 two kind of model, it is easy to the construction of underground airtight wall.The readily removable fragment of brick cement of the airtight pressure-bearing of this mine laneway, sand and microlith are raw material, according to special industrial mould, make fragment of brick hollow frame, and hollow position has partition wall to be isolated into some spaces, carry out sand filling in space, and after filling, compacting forms further.
When underground construction fire dam, just can, according to the design of fire dam, airtight for the mine laneway readily removable fragment of brick of pressure-bearing be carried out airtight together with other plugging material in advance.Due to the internal sand for filling of the readily removable fragment of brick of the airtight pressure-bearing of this mine laneway, when abolishing fire dam, utilize ambulance corps's instrument just can easily by airtight dismounting in 30 minutes.Reduce the work risk of rescue team member, it is ensured that the safety of rescue personnel.
